Output d66e35e429000b134755895601c25fbf1ee882739cd926ad05d16c9c686243c5:3
- value
- 21309
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3ca7d3f4916548280f4963cdc4a375d7ba2441ebc6fb1ad1a623ee0c630f1f18
- address
- tb1p8jna8ay3v4yzsr6fv0xufgm467azgs0tcma345dxy0hqccc0ruvq6stz0z
- transaction
- d66e35e429000b134755895601c25fbf1ee882739cd926ad05d16c9c686243c5